
After your Woolfson LASIK procedure, you will receive a pair of protective sunglasses that you will be asked to wear over the next few days. You will also receive a Post Procedure Kit including all your drops, eye shields, and medication to help you sleep.
Your eye(s) may feel slightly irritated or you may tear-up or water for a few hours. If you experience any discomfort, your surgeon will suggest a mild pain reliever. However, most patients go home when asked, take their sleeping medication, and after a bit of rest wearing protective eye shields are quite comfortable. You will be reminded NOT to rub or touch your eyes during the early healing stage.
You will be able to return to work the following day, however you will need to follow certain restrictions mentioned below and any others provided to you by your surgeon after your procedure. Apart from your post procedure instructions, you will be free to resume all your normal activities.
